Middle School Is Worse Than Meatloaf by Jennifer Holm

What a great book! Ginny's entire year is "told through stuff." The reader gets to find out all about Ginny's first year in middle school by reading her emails, text messages, report cards, bank account statements and more. This is a visually stimulating and exciting version of a diary. Suggest this book to girl fans of the Diary of a Wimpy Kid series.

Clementine, The Talented Clementine, by Sara Pennypacker

Okay, so these are fairly old titles, but I have just finished listening to both audio books and let me tell you, HILARIOUS! Clementine is the funniest character I have come across since Ramona. She is such a smart little girl...always thinking and trying to figure out stuff, "Okay fine..." she is quite the ornery little girl. She is always getting herself into odd situations...for example, in the first book, within the first few chapters, she "helps" a classmate cut her hair. I laughed hysterically as I listened to these two books on CD and am starting Clementine's Letter this evening!
